Biochem/physiol Actions
Cytoprotective PGE1 analog that prevents NSAID-induced gastric ulceration.
PGE1 analog prodrug which is rapidly de-esterified to active "misoprostolic acid". Cited for extremely wide-ranging therapeutic effects, including prevention of NSAID-induced gastric ulceration, regulation of immunologic cascades, inhibition of platelet-activating factor (PAF), treatment of ethanol- and acetaminophen-induced hepatotoxicity and hepatitis, and stimulation of cartilage repair after injury.
